WebIn the Panhandle, yields averaged 10-15 bushels per acres for dryland wheat and 40-60 for irrigated wheat. According to Attebury Grain, quality was mostly good, with test weights averaging 58-60 pounds per bushel and protein over 12%. Producers expected harvest to be complete within a week to ten days. In Mehring’s trials he also counted how many seeds on … WebFor every inch of available moisture 2.6 to 3.5 bushels of wheat per acre can be produced. One fall irrigation is often necessary for good livestock grazing. If needed, irrigate soon after emergence in order to get the crop established as quickly as possible.
